A WhatsApp group will be created where players will be added to provide updates and maintain smooth communication. - Infinity Tournament: The tournament will consist of 5 rounds, mid-tier, following the ITS rules in effect at the time of play. Deadline for uploading lists to the Manager and sending them by email to the organization: October 19, 2025. - Missions: 300 points and 6 CAPS *To be defined awaiting the new ITS There will be five tables with a different terrain type each, which will provide the corresponding movement bonus. - Aquatic - Desert - Mountain - Jungle - 0-G All players must bring everything necessary to play their games: markers, dice, cards, silhouettes, etc. Lines of sight must be clearly marked and visible on all miniatures. Use of proxies will be allowed according to current ITS rules, and it must be clear to all players which profile and equipment it represents. - Pairings: Pairings will be organized using the OTM manager provided by Corvus Belli and will be announced at the start of each round, following the Swiss tournament format. In the first round, efforts will be made to avoid matchups between players from the same gaming group or community. In the last round, the first will play against the second and the last against the second-to-last, unless they have already played each other. - Timings: Each game will last 2:00 hours, and each player is responsible for their own and their opponent's time. The organization will provide time warnings so players can assess their gameplay and agree on a final turn if needed. The use of a chess clock is optional. If one of the two players decides to use a chess clock, both must use it. In the last round on table one, its useis mandatory. - Reporting results: When submitting results, please include the objective points, survivors, and the game table, handing in both players' control sheets. Failure to submit results within the established time may result in a bye for both players. - Judging: Before calling a judge, players are expected to know the rules and carry a digital or printed copy for reference in case of doubt. If a question or issue arises that players cannot resolve among themselves during the game, they should call for a judge immediately. Judges will follow the following resolution mechanics: If it is a doubt requiring their intervention, they will listen to the involved parties, review the relevant rules, assess the most feasible resolution, and make a decision. Remember that the goal is to resolve the situation blocking the game as quickly and accurately as possible. If that is not possible, then the most fair and balanced resolution will be applied, recognizing the fallibility of human judgment.
